The 1881 Census reveals a detailed snapshot of households in England, Wales and Scotland. The census was taken on April 3rd and the total population was recorded as 29,707,207.

In the 1881 Census, the household of Henry Shevlin, born in 1829 in Armagh, consisted of 4 members. Henry was the head of the household, married to Catherine E Shevlin, born in 1840 in Hulme, Lancashire, England. They had 2 children; Arthur F (born 1874 in Hulme, Lancashire, England) and Joseph M (born 1870 in Hulme, Lancashire, England).
